Government audit, characterized by systematic examinations and evaluations of public sector organizations, is pivotal in ensuring the integrity, transparency, and accountability of public finances. Given this scenario, this paper presents a comprehensive exploration of the integration of Machine Learning (ML) within Government Auditing, with a specific focus on financial statements, and to study how ML has influenced the analysis and decision-making of the auditors. Following the PRISMA methodology, this literature review explored publications from the past five years using keywords in both English and Portuguese to ensure comprehensive coverage. The review revealed the multifaceted applications of ML in various contexts of financial auditing within governments worldwide, elucidating the diverse approaches employed in these scenarios and their success rates, providing valuable insights into emerging trends and best practices. Overall, this paper contributes to advancing knowledge and understanding of ML in Government Auditing, providing valuable insights for practitioners, policymakers, and researchers in the field.
